First person arrives on Nauru triggering Australia’s $2.5bn deal with island nation
Deal between federal government and Nauru expected to last 30 years and apply to around 350 people released under high court’s NZYQ rulingFollow our Australia news live blog for latest updatesGet our breaking news email, free app or daily news podcastAustralia has commenced its $2.5bn deal with...
